Giant Panda

Article posted October 12, 2010 at 11:48 PM GMT0 • comment • Reads 178

Giant Pandas are a part of the big bear family because they are a type of bear.

Habitat
Giant Pandas live in Central China in bushes, mountains, trees and bamboo forests.

Predators
Predators are animals that eat other animals. Leopards, wild dogs, black panther , foxes are some of the predators of the Giant Panda. That is one reason why they are dying out.

Characteristics
Giant Pandas are black and white with fluffy all over. They have black rings around their eyes they also have black hands, feet, nose and ears. When a new born baby is born its mother is about 900 times bigger than its newborn baby. When a new born Giant Panda is born it has think pink skin and a long tail.

Classification
Female Giant Pandas can grow up to 4 feet tall, and weigh up to 82kg. Male pandas can grow up to 5 feet and weigh up to 100kg.

Climate
In winter the Giant Panda do not get that cold because they have thick fluffy coats. In summer they get hot because of their coat. If the Giant Panda goes in water it doesn’t matter because they have a waterproof -coat.

Numbers
The Giant Pandas number and dropping slowly because of predators and their habitat loss. In the zoos around the world there are from 160-240 Giant Pandas in zoos. In the wild there is around 1600 Giant Pandas. There is about 1840 Giant Pandas left in the world.

Summary
Giant Pandas are a part of the bear family but they are still endangered so save them!
